Job Description

Overview

Serve as the Delivery Lead for the EMEA Transportation Control Tower (12+ Countries), accountable for end-to-end program delivery from mobilization through stabilization. Orchestrate cross-functional stakeholders across global, sector, and business-unit teams govern the integrated plan and timeline and ensure delivery of all business-case KPIs. Partner tightly with technical teams to translate requirements into deployable solutions, manage scope and dependencies, and lead process, organization, and change-management workstreams-including onboarding and training of impacted teams. Provide financial stewardship (budget, benefits tracking, variance management) and proactive risk/issue management to secure on-time, on-budget delivery and measurable value realization for EMEA.


Responsibilities

  • Lead the end-to-end delivery of the EMEA Transportation Control Tower (TCT) program, ensuring all phases-mobilization, design, build, test, and deployment-are executed to plan.
  • Establish and manage the integrated master plan, timelines, dependencies, and critical path across functions and markets.
  • Maintain governance forums, progress reporting, and project health reviews with executive stakeholders.
  • Drive alignment between global, sector, and business-unit stakeholders, ensuring clarity on objectives, deliverables, and success metrics.
  • Serve as the central liaison across business, technology, and capability teams to maintain a single source of truth and ensure transparency.
  • Partner with technical teams to define, validate, and prioritize business requirements for solution delivery.
  • Ensure seamless integration between business processes, systems, and data flows to enable TCT functionality and interoperability.
  • Support testing, user acceptance, and deployment readiness activities.
  • Oversee project financials, including budget tracking, cost management, and benefit realization against business-case KPIs.
  • Ensure productivity and efficiency targets are met, validating financial outcomes post-implementation.
  • Lead process design, optimization, and standardization across participating markets and functions.
  • Support adoption through robust change management, training, and onboarding plans.
  • Embed new ways of working aligned to global TCT operating model principles.
  • Identify, assess, and mitigate delivery risks, dependencies, and potential bottlenecks.
  • Escalate critical issues proactively with mitigation strategies to ensure project continuity.
  • Track implementation progress against defined KPIs, milestones, and governance metrics.
  • Capture and institutionalize lessons learned to enhance subsequent TCT deployments.

Qualifications

  • Experience in transportation management, control tower implementation, people management and digital transformation projects
  • Experience in Control Tower implementations, with interface with technical teams and vendors
  • Minimum 15 years experience in Supply Chain, ideally in warehousing and transportation
  • Experience in project management and transformational programs, with PMO Skills
  • Strategic transformation mindset, considering process, people and technology
  • Communication, presentation and relationship management experience

About Company

PepsiCo, Inc. is an American multinational food, snack, and beverage corporation headquartered in Harrison, New York, in the hamlet of Purchase. PepsiCo's business encompasses all aspects of the food and beverage market. It oversees the manufacturing, distribution, and marketing of its products. PepsiCo was formed in 1965 with the merger of the Pepsi-Cola Company and Frito-Lay, Inc. PepsiCo has since expanded from its namesake product Pepsi Cola to an immensely diversified range of food and beverage brands. The largest and most recent acquisition was Pioneer Foods in 2020 for $1.7bn [3] and before that it was the Quaker Oats Company in 2001, which added the Gatorade brand to the Pepsi portfolio and Tropicana Products in 1998.
